Before The Harvey Comics

img

Trivia time.
A lot of people don't know that Casper, Baby Huey, Buzzy Crow, Little Audrey, and the cat and mouse duo Herman And Katnip were NOT original Harvey Comics characters. Actually, all of them were created by the animators at Paramount's Famous Studios, with the exception of Casper, who was created by freelancers that were not on staff.
So there ya go. Y'all just learned something. To help you remember, here's a few pages of comics that pre-date the Harvey era. You'll likely notice that prior to these characters being purchased by Harvey they looked very different. That's very evident. Why they changed the looks, I really don't know for certain. But I believe it was a marketing thing in much the same way that Stan Lee or Walt Disney wanted to have an immediately recognizable style to match their brand names.

Casper And The Evil Planet

Casper

Moving forward into the 1970s, both Casper and Richie Rich began to have longer and much more fantastic adventures. I honestly can't remember either of them having had more than a full 20 page adventure, but this was still a step up from the previous 10 page limit that existed before. It was also during this period that the numerous characters would begin to officially cross over and appear in stories together (with the notable exceptions Hot Stuff and Stumbo, who for all intents and purposes, lived on Harvey's Earth-2, I guess).
This story isn't one of the classic Richie/Casper crossovers (but I will post one eventually), but it does feature an amusing spoof of classic character Flash Gordon. Although this is not a very flattering parody as you'll see now.
